Iconic Landmarks of Lisbon

Lisbon, the captivating capital of Portugal, boasts an array of iconic landmarks that captivate visitors from around the world. From the majestic Belem Tower and Jerónimos Monastery to the towering Christ the King statue and the historic São Jorge Castle, each site offers a unique glimpse into the city’s rich cultural heritage. Visitors can stroll through the charming Alfama district, marvel at the panoramic views from various vantage points, and indulge in the renowned Pastéis de Nata at the famous Pasteis de Belem. The tour’s flexibility allows guests to customize their experience, ensuring an unforgettable exploration of Lisbon’s wonders.
| Landmark | Significance | Highlight |
|———-|————–|———–|
| Belem Tower | 16th-century UNESCO World Heritage site | Distinctive Manueline architecture |
| Jerónimos Monastery | Magnificent 16th-century monastery | Stunning cloisters and church |
| Christ the King | Iconic statue overlooking the city | Panoramic views of Lisbon |
| São Jorge Castle | Majestic hilltop fortress with a rich history | Breathtaking panoramic vistas |

Savoring Pastéis De Nata

Among the highlights of the Lisbon City Wonders Tour is the opportunity to savor the iconic Pastéis de Nata at the renowned Pastéis de Belem. These famous custard tarts are a beloved Portuguese delicacy, featuring a crisp, flaky pastry shell encasing a rich, creamy custard filling. Visitors can enjoy the Pastéis de Nata freshly baked and still warm, accompanied by a strong cup of coffee. The Pasteis de Belem bakery is the original creator of this iconic treat, dating back to the 19th century. Indulging in these delectable pastries is a must-do during the Lisbon City Wonders Tour.
